Reverse Fly with External Rotation

Trains the Shoulders, Infraspinatus and Teres Minor.

How to do it

  1. Sit on the end of a bench with a light dumbbell in each hand, or stand and hinge forward at the hips.
  2. Lean forward so your chest is close to your thighs and let the dumbbells hang below you, palms facing each other.
  3. Set a soft bend in your elbows and hold it.
  4. Raise both dumbbells out to your sides in a wide arc until your arms are level with your shoulders.
  5. At the top, rotate your forearms upward so your thumbs point toward the ceiling — this is the external rotation the name refers to, and it is the part most people leave out.
  6. Reverse the rotation, then lower the arms under control back to the start.
